17 Jan 2012 Redwood Shores - Oracle's Sun Fire X4800 M2 server has set an x86 world record, beating the best x86 results from IBM and HP on the TPC-C benchmark. This adds to Oracle's overall TPC-C world record result.
Oracle's Sun Fire X4800 M2, running Oracle Linux with the Unbreakable Enterprise Kernel Release 2, Oracle Tuxedo, and Oracle Database 11g Release 2, achieved 4,803,718 transactions per minute (tpmC) with a price/performance of $.98/tpmC.
In this benchmark, the Sun Fire X4800 M2 server equipped with eight Intel Xeon E7-8870 processors and 4TB of Samsung's Green DDR3 memory, is nearly 3x faster than the best published eight-processor result posted by an IBM p570 server equipped with eight Power 6 processors and running DB2. Moreover, Oracle Database 11g running on the Sun Fire X4800 M2 server is nearly 60 percent faster than the best DB2 result running on IBM's x86 server.
With just eight processors, Oracle's Sun Fire X4800 M2 server surpassed the best published HP result posted by a 64-processor HP Superdome server and delivered nearly 3x better price per TPC-C transaction. Compared to HP's best x86 score with the Proliant DL580 G7, running Microsoft SQL Server, the Oracle solution is over 2.65x faster.
